Best Quotes about Courage
Live as brave men and face adversity with stout hearts.
Horace
That's a valiant flea that dares eat his breakfast on the lip of a lion.
Shakespeare, William
Courage is a quality so necessary for maintaining virtue, that it is always respected, even when it is associated with vice.
Johnson, Samuel
Nothing splendid has ever been achieved except by those who dared believe that something inside them was superior to circumstance.
Barton, Bruce
Courage enlarges, cowardice diminishes resources. In desperate straits the fears of the timid aggravate the dangers that imperil the brave.
Bovee, Christian Nevell
Never ask the Gods for life set free from grief, but ask for courage that endureth long.
Menander of Athens
Life only demands from you the strength that you possess. Only one feat is possible; not to run away.
Hammarskjold, Dag
The beauty of the soul shines out when a man bears with composure one heavy mischance after another, not because he does not feel them, but because he is a man of high and heroic temper.
Aristotle
Be courageous. I have seen many depressions in business. Always America has emerged from these stronger and more prosperous. Be brave as your fathers before you. Have faith! Go forward!
Edison, Thomas A.
It is impossible to win the race unless you venture to run, impossible to win the victory unless you dare to battle.
DeVos, Richard M.
Because of a great love, one is courageous.
Lao-Tzu
Discoveries are often made by not following instructions, by going off the main road, by trying the untried.
Tyger, Frank
It takes vision and courage to create -- it takes faith and courage to prove.
Young, Owen D.
'Tis easy enough to be pleasant, When life flows along like a song; But the man worth while is the one who will smile when everything goes dead wrong.
Wilcox, Ella Wheeler
You take a number of small steps which you believe are right, thinking maybe tomorrow somebody will treat this as a dangerous provocation. And then you wait. If there is no reaction, you take another step: courage is only an accumulation of small steps.
Konrad, George
Be strong and of a good courage, fear not, nor be afraid... for the Lord thy God, he it is that doth go with thee; he will not fail thee, nor forsake thee.
Deuteronomy
The bravest are the most tender; the loving are the daring.
Taylor, Bayard
Courage is the capacity to conduct oneself with restraint in times of prosperity and with courage and tenacity when things do not go well.
Forrestal, James V.
Part of courage is simple consistency.
Noonan, Peggy
If we must fall, we should boldly meet the danger.
Tacitus, Publius Cornelius
The acorn becomes an oak by means of automatic growth; no commitment is necessary. The kitten similarly becomes a cat on the basis of instinct. Nature and being are identical in creatures like them. But a man or woman becomes fully human only by his or her choices and his or her commitment to them. People attain worth and dignity by the multitude of decisions they make from day by day. These decisions require courage.
May, Rollo
Act boldly and unseen forces will come to your aid.
Brande, Dorothea
I advise you to say your dream is possible and then overcome all inconveniences, ignore all the hassles and take a running leap through the hoop, even if it is in flames.
Brown, Les
It is in great dangers that we see great courage.
Regnard, Jean Francois
No fact of human nature is more characteristic that its willingness to live on a chance.
No man in the world has more courage than the man who can stop after eating one peanut.
Pollock, Channing
Do not fear, for those who are with us, are more than those who are with them. [2 Kings 6:16]
Bible
True courage is cool and calm. The bravest of men have the least of a brutal, bullying insolence, and in the very time of danger are found the most serene and free.
Shaftesbury, Lord
Have the courage to say no. Have the courage to face the truth. Do the right thing because it is right. These are the magic keys to living your life with integrity.
Stone, W. Clement
Courage is resistance to fear, mastery of fear - not absence of fear.
Mark Twain
Courage is not simply one of the virtues but the form of every virtue at the testing point, which means at the point of highest reality.
Lewis, C. S.
Stand upright, speak thy thoughts, declare the truth thou hast, that all may share; Be bold, proclaim it everywhere: They only live who dare.
Morris, Lewis
If we have the courage and tenacity of our forebears, who stood firmly like a rock against the lash of slavery, we shall find a way to do for our day what they did for theirs.
Bethune, Mary Mcleod
A great deal of talent is lost in the world for want of courage.
Smith, Sydney
I think of those who were truly great. The names of those who in their lives fought for life, Who wore at their hearts the fire's center.
Spender, Stephen
True courage is like a kite; a contrary wind raises it higher.
Petit-Senn, John
Flatter me, and I may not believe you. Criticize me, and I may not like you. Ignore me, and I may not forgive you. Encourage me, and I may not forget you.
Arthur, William
Courage means to keep working a relationship, to continue seeking solutions to difficult problems, and to stay focused during stressful periods.
Waitley, Denis
For the man sound of body and serene of mind there is no such thing as bad weather; every day has its beauty, and storms which whip the blood do but make it pulse more vigorously.
Gissing, George Robert
Bravery is the capacity to perform properly even when scared half to death.
Bradley, Omar
Like a boxer in a title fight, you have to walk in that ring alone.
Joel, Billy
It takes a certain courage and a certain greatness to be truly base.
Anouilh, Jean
No one can be brave who considers pain to be the greatest evil in life, or can they be temperate who considers pleasure to be the highest good.
Cicero, Marcus T.
The real acid test of courage is to be just your honest self when everybody is trying to be like somebody else.
Jensen, Andrew
We need to find the courage to say NO to the things and people that are not serving us if we want to rediscover ourselves and live our lives with authenticity.
Angelis, Barbara De
Courage, not compromise, brings the smile of God's approval.
Monson, Thomas S.
It is a blessed thing that in every age some one has had the individuality enough and courage enough to stand by his own convictions.
Ingersoll, Robert Green
Courage consists in equality to the problem before us.
Emerson, Ralph Waldo
Fortune and love favor the brave.
Ovid
It is amidst great perils we see brave hearts.
Regnard, Jean Francois
